Then, what is IKEA’s new kitchen design?

Some have found that iKEA’s new kitchen cabinet design sits the top rails 1/8″ higher than the cabinet sides. This means the vast majority of the countertop weight is resting on a few places instead of the entire side of the cabinet box. The IKEA FIXA brackets add 1/8″, which allows the stone countertop load to be carried entirely by the cabinet boxes.

This begs the question “What guarantees does IKEA offer when buying a kitchen?”

You know, one of the most important factors when buying a kitchen is the guarantee that is assured by the retailer. Even in this IKEA does not disappoint offering 25 years of guarantees on possible defects in the factory and materials of kitchen cabinets.

Is it worth it to hire an IKEA kitchen designer?

“An IKEA kitchen can look really bad or really good,” Grote, who has designed 170 kitchens, says. “It is worth your time to hire a designer. There are so many aspects of kitchen design to make sure it functions well.” A number of designers like Grote specialize in designing IKEA kitchens, and of course there’s help available at the store itself.

Are ikea induction hobs any good?

Ikea is not just good for flat pack furniture. This induction hob has all sorts of clever features and in the scheme of things is not too pricy either. It boasts a power booster to help with boiling water or for searing meat quickly and an anti-overflow detector will cleverly turn off the hob if a pan spills over.
